Almost a Pro V1, just half the price and one less layer, but it really is a superior ball because..... Almost a Pro V1, just half the price and one less layer, but it really is a superior ball because the Tour version isn't error correcting. Most golf balls are designed to actually straighten out if mis hit with excessive side spin. Don't ask me how it works, I can't explain it but I've read numerous articles that explain how and you can find them too. The Tour version is two layer ball, the NXT Extreme (formerly just NXT) is a single core ball. Golf pros have the ability to power fade or draw golf shots around dog legs, this can be accomplished with a combination of wrist and elbow position at impact and changes in stance. Thailand ready to take on the world
Asian team tipped to dethrone Scotland

CHUAH CHOO CHIANG



DONGGUAN, CHINA : Asian stars are ready to ride on the feel good factor and challenge for top honours at the Omega Mission Hills World Cup which begins tomorrow.
Thongchai and Prayad also represented Thailand last year.
Lin Wen-tang's memorable victory in Hong Kong on Sunday highlighted a memorable past few weeks for the Asian Tour which also celebrated wins from India's Jeev Milkha Singh and Thailand's Prayad Marksaeng in Singapore and Japan respectively.
All three players will represent their nations at Mission Hills Golf Club and confidence is running high that an Asian nation can dethrone Scotland of their World Cup crown.
"Asian players are getting strong. Anybody can win tournaments these days. This week, we'll have a good chance as well. We'll try but sometimes, you need the element of luck to win," said Thailand's Thongchai Jaidee, who is a two-time Asian number one.
Last year, Thongchai partnered Prayad, who is fresh off a third victory of the season in Japan at the Dunlop Phoenix tournament, to finish tied 15th. The Thais will again wear coordinated colours this week in hope of enjoying a successful week at Mission Hills.
"If we can win the World Cup, it'll be very good for our country. We will try to win this week although it wont be easy. We'll be using the same colours, same golf bags, and our caddies will also be in same outfits. It's a team event and we want to act as a team," said Thongchai.
Lin will make his Omega Mission Hills World Cup debut for Taiwan where he will partner seasoned campaigner Lu Wen-teh, who is also making his first appearance in the prestigious team competition which was inaugurated in 1953.
After pulling off a memorable play-off victory at the UBS Hong Kong Open, Lin, who has risen to 51st on the world rankings, is hoping to ride on his rich vein of form to reproduce Taiwan's lone victory in the World Cup dating back to 1972.
"With the success of Asian players in recent weeks, there is a feeling that we can win the big events, even this week. Our confidence is high and we've got a feel good attitude now," said Lin, currently second on the Asian Tour's Order of Merit. >>> more >>

Back Swing Takeaway


Back Swing Takeaway
Step One - Setup
We’ll start, of course, with your correct golf stance and club grip. The club head should be floating just above the ground behind the ball. I then do the little things that get me loose and relaxed (to each his own).
Step Two - Hinge arm/Cock wrists
(This is the beginning of where anyone who knows anything about golf will begin to disagree with me.)I start my golf back swing, or golf swing takeaway, by bringing the golf club head back, however, I don’t focus on the club head. Instead I think of the arm as being hinged at my left shoulder. Then, like a gate that swings open from it’s hinges, the left arm hinges at the left shoulder and swings across the body until it approaches the right side at my right armpit. The left arm remains relatively straight, but could bend slightly.My shoulder and upper body turn begin as the left arm reaches this position.
As the arms go back, two things should happen.
First, the forearms will naturally rotate clockwise slightly until the golf club head points to the sky. Opening the club face more won’t seem right to you if you tend to slice, but don’t resist this very natural movement.Second, as your arms travel up and back and the golf club shaft approaches parallel to the ground, you will gradually begin cocking your wrists. Then by the time that your left arm is parallel to the ground, your wrists should be completely cocked at a 90 degree angle.(This is the last time we discuss or think about the position of your arms.)Cocking your wrists is a very important part of creating club head speed. This was one of my big swing problems. I was so concerned about “taking the club straight back” at the beginning of my back swing that I never completely cocked my wrists. Fixing this straightened out several of my golf swing problems

Amazon.com Review No athlete has changed his sport the way Tiger Woods has transformed the world of golf. The Tiger phenomenon has created a new legion of golfers, seduced by Woods's almost effortless mastery of this most difficult game. In How I Play Golf Woods reveals the many facets of his game and offers a plethora of tips and advice aimed at all levels of play. Unlike most golf guides, and perhaps somewhat surprising from a player best known for his long game, How I Play Golf begins with the short game--putting, chipping, and pitching--before moving onto swing mechanics and hitting off the tee. Produced in conjunction with the editors of Golf Digest, the book is lavishly photographed and illustrated and offers a gold mine of useful ideas and mental images Tiger has collected over the years. Throughout, Tiger recounts memorable shots from his relatively brief career; for example, his only "perfect" shot (a 3-wood on No. 14 at St. Andrews) and his first putt at the 1995 Masters (a 20-footer for birdie on No. 1 that missed and rolled off the green). How I Play Golf is not only a first-rate instructional guide, it also communicates a passion and respect for the game that beginners, hackers, and low handicappers should find inspiring. From Publishers Weekly Very few sports figures have accomplished as much as Woods has already achieved at age 25. He has been named "Sportsman of the Year" by Sports Illustrated twice; he has won more than 30 professional tournaments and he's the youngest player to win the Grand Slam four of the major pro championships. Despite his many commercials and product endorsements, Woods is one of the rare athletes who isn't overplayed in the media. Unlike many other sports stars, Woods plays and wins quietly. That may explain why this instructional book will reach far beyond the links. Woods talks about his experiences and his attitudes toward golf and life. The conversational tone is quite engaging: "The difference between golf and most other sports is that anyone of average intelligence and coordination can learn to play it well. It requires a commitment to being the best that you can be. That has always been my approach to the game.... Pop gave me many great lessons, not only about golf, but also about life. His greatest advice to me was always be myself." On watching the ball, Woods says, "If you're like me, you can't wait to see if the ball is tracking toward the hole right after the golf ball leaves the putterface.... The tendency to peek too soon causes your head to move and leads to off-sloppy contact.... I found an effective way to fight the problem: I practice putting with my left eye closed, so I can't see the target line at all with my peripheral vision. That makes it easier to keep my eyes looking straight down." Accompanied by wonderful photos, the book reads as if Woods is right there with the golfer, providing instructions. (Oct.)
